venting


The release of excessive internal pressure from a cell in a manner intended by design to preclude explosion.

venting


venting is done to prevent the build-up of pressure in the body cavity of a valve. All carbon steel and stainless steel balls are slot vented as standard. Option -20, "slot vented ball may be ordered on any brass or bronze valves and option -14, "side vented ball", is available on either brass or stainless balls.

venting


The controlled release of unburned gases directly into the atmosphere. The option to release gas to the atmosphere by flaring or venting is an essential practice in oil and gas production, primarily for safety reasons.
